Job Summary and Qualifications

JOB TITLE - Associate Recruiter GENERAL SUMMARY OF DUTIES: Responsible for the sourcing of candidates for the recruitment and placement of clinical and non-clinical staff to fill posted position within the HCA affiliated facilities or other organizations as directed. The Associate Recruiter will generate productive candidate recruitment sources to build a qualified candidate pool for Permanent Placement recruitment. The Associate Recruiter provides assistance in: placement with facilities; relocation issues; and obtains data for the candidate concerning the hospital, the community attributes including local real estate options and local school system information and any other data that may assist with a relocation decision as needed or directed. SUPERVISOR - Director of Recruitment 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S INCLUDE BUT ARE NOT LIMITED TO: · Primary function is to source candidates primarily via telephone for existing candidates within the database and new candidate development via cold calling utilizing other approved resources as directed to fill open positions for client hospitals and facilities · Maintain candidate profiles in database and updates information as needed · Prequalify candidates for open positions by determining appropriate position requirements · Provide information to candidates on requirements of positions, market, location and verify actual availability and level of interest of candidates for placement · Submit qualified candidates to recruiters for their review and approval · Follow up with the recruiters on pending candidates and maintain communication with candidate as needed · Occasionally assist hospital with verifying status of candidates post interview · Other duties as assigned EDUCATION -High School Diploma or GED Equivalent required; College Degree or coursework preferred EXPERIENCE - Prefer 1-2 years experience in recruiting environment Benefits
